The story of St. Michaeliskirche is one of resilience. This is no ordinary church; it has survived battles, wars, and even the ravages of time, but still stands proudly today as a testament to the city's eternal spirit. The original St. Michaeliskirche was built in the late 17th century, with construction beginning in 1647. But like many places, the church's journey was not a smooth one, and in 1750, just a few years after it was built, a fire destroyed the entire building. However, the citizens were determined to rebuild the church. The reconstructed church was built in today's Baroque style, and its distinctive onion-head dome has become synonymous with the Hamburg skyline. Throughout its long history, St. Michaeliskirche has been a place of refuge, a place of worship and a symbol of the city's ability to rise again, no matter how many difficulties it has faced. The significance of the church goes beyond its architectural beauty, as it played a key role in the Great Fire of Hamburg in 1842, when the city's citizens took refuge from the fighting. It became a place of refuge for the people of Hamburg and further deepened the collective memory of the city.

A masterpiece of baroque design

A masterpiece of baroque design

As you approach St. Michaeliskirche, it is impossible to ignore its majesty. With its baroque design, graceful curves, intricate details and majestic spire, the church is an architectural masterpiece. The exterior of the church is adorned with statues and decorative elements that contrast with the surrounding modern buildings, making it a prominent landmark on the city skyline. One of the church's most striking features is its soaring spire, which rises to a staggering height of 132 meters and overlooks the entire city and surrounding harbor. The spire is not only a visual spectacle, it is also a signpost for sailors on their arrival, symbolizing the city's seafaring history and the importance of the sea in the life of the city. The interior of the church is a full display of Baroque style. The wide nave is flanked by large columns that lead you upwards to the ornate ceiling, which is painted with scenes that tell of faith and divine revelations. The intricate carvings and golden details on the altar are the focal point of the church, drawing visitors to appreciate its beauty and serenity. Tall windows allow natural light to pour in, illuminating the rich colors and detailed craftsmanship that make the church so striking.

Stepping into St. Michaeliskirche is like entering a world of peace and tranquility. The interior of the church is simple yet captivating, with breathtakingly high ceilings, a wide nave and a beautiful altar. A sense of serene reverence pervades the entire space, inviting the visitor to spend a moment in contemplation or simply to enjoy the beauty of the surroundings. The church is still an active place of worship, so visitors will often hear the sound of the organ or the soft murmur of prayer as they visit. The organ itself is one of the largest in northern Germany, with over 4,000 pipes, and is a highlight of any visit to the church. Music fills the entire space, adding another layer of beauty to the experience. One of the most intriguing aspects of the church's interior is the ornate frescoes that adorn the ceiling. Created in the Baroque style, these paintings depict biblical scenes and divine visions, adding a sense of grandeur to the church's design. The rich colors and intricate details entice visitors to stop and admire these masterpieces of art.

In addition to its architectural beauty, St. Michaeliskirche houses a number of historical artifacts, including mausoleums and monuments to famous Hamburg citizens. As you stroll through the church, you'll see monuments to military leaders, politicians, and artists, each of whom played an important role in the city's history. These historic touches remind visitors that St. Michaeliskirche is more than just a place of worship; it is a living testament to Hamburg's past.
